WebApr 9, 2024 · Click on "Conditional Formatting" in the "Home" tab. Click on "New Rule". Choose "Use a formula to determine which cells to format". In the "Format values where this formula is true" field, enter the following formula: =C3=G3 Click on the "Format" button. In the "Fill" tab, select the green color you want to use for the background. WebOct 5, 2024 · Conditional formatting data bars should not be confused with bar charts - kind of Excel graph that represents different categories of data in the form of rectangular bars. While a bar chart is a separate object that can be moved anywhere on the sheet, data bars always reside inside individual cells. WebMar 7, 2024 · Answer. not with a pivot chart, unless you change the underlying table. Conceptually, "conditional formatting of columns" is not a feature of charts. The workaround is to create a data series for each "color" and use these different series instead of the original single data series in a stacked column chart.
